Menu
小程序资讯
小程序资讯
小程序解包
时间:2024-03-27 04:54:03

小程序成为如今移动互联网领域非常热门的应用之一。它以其轻巧、便捷的特点,让用户能够在不下载安装的情况下,直接使用各种功能。然而,有时候我们可能会对某个小程序的功能产生好奇,想要深入研究它的内部实现。这时,就需要进行小程序解包了。

小程序解包是指将原本被加密处理的小程序文件进行解密,以方便分析和研究。目前,市面上有很多解包工具可供使用,比如微信小程序开发工具、Python脚本等。接下来,我们将从不同角度来介绍小程序解包的方法和技巧。

我们可以利用微信小程序开发工具进行解包。首先,我们需要将相关的小程序文件导出到我们的本地目录。在微信小程序开发工具的项目设置中,我们可以找到“本地设置”选项,点击“代码上传配置”后,勾选“上传代码时同时上传已编译好的源代码文件(即app-x.x.x.zip)”。这样,在编译发布小程序时,就会同时生成一个相应的ZIP压缩包,里面包含了小程序的所有源代码文件。我们只需要将这个ZIP文件解压开来,就可以看到小程序的源代码和资源文件了。

我们可以使用Python脚本进行小程序解包。Python是一种简洁而强大的编程语言,可以在各个操作系统上运行,并且有丰富的第三方库支持。我们可以使用Python的zipfile库对小程序进行解压。首先,我们需要下载并安装Python环境。然后,创建一个Python脚本,导入zipfile库,使用open方法打开小程序的ZIP文件,然后使用extractall方法将文件解压到指定目录。这样,我们就可以得到小程序的源代码和资源文件了。

除了上述方法,还有一些在线解包工具可以供我们使用。这些工具通常提供了简洁的用户界面,只需要上传小程序文件,点击解包按钮,就可以得到解密后的文件。这些工具的原理与前面介绍的方法大致相同,只是实现方式不同而已。

小程序解包

通过小程序解包,我们可以进一步研究小程序的实现细节,了解其内部机制。对于开发人员来说,这是学习和借鉴杰出小程序的好机会,可以学到许多设计和开发的技巧。对于普通用户来说,这是了解小程序背后故事的窗口,可以更好地欣赏和利用小程序的功能。

我们在进行小程序解包时,需要注意一些法律和道德的约束。首先,我们不能将解包后的文件用于商业用途,不能将其作为自己的原创作品进行发布和销售。其次,我们要尊重开发者的劳动成果,不得将其源代码和资源文件用于恶意篡改、盗取用户个人信息等违法行为。只有在学习和研究的目的下,对于合法的小程序进行解包,才是被允许的。

起来,小程序解包是一项有趣而又有挑战的任务。通过不同的解包方法,我们可以打开小程序的大门,深入了解其内部机制和实现细节。然而,在进行解包之前,我们要明确解包的目的,并且遵守法律和道德规范,将解包技术用于正确的领域中。

更多和“小程序”相关的文章

咨询
微信扫码咨询
电话咨询
021-61554458